One particular kind of fence has been popular for centuries now and is called the white picket fence. Picket fences are traditionally white in color – hence the name! Traditionally it was made out of wooden planks tapered around the tops and painted white. These wooden planks used to be burrowed into the ground keeping their tops usually at the same height or sometimes at different heights to make a pattern. These planks of wood were kept in line and intact with the help of a wooden shaft running horizontally from the posts at the ends of the fence. The posts are usually dug deep into the ground to provide sufficient stability to the fence. The planks of wood are called pickets and their tops are sometimes shaped as dog ears or otherwise shaped in a bit more rounded fashion. The height of the pickets is kept usually from thirty six inches to forty eight inches from ground. The material of choice for the white picket fence have undergone changes though, in the recent times, because of the need to save trees. Hence, a more modern material has now become available in the market for the job - Polyvinyl chloride. This is the best replacement for wood as it offers more strength and durability to the fence. Wooden fences also require much more maintenance and care to keep them looking good all the time, which is not much of a problem with these new materials.
